Respondents PRAYER: Writ Petition is fil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ying for the issuance of a Writ of Mandamus directing the respondents 2 to 4 to convene a peace committee meeting forthwith and to ensure equal participation and contribution of all community people in the Arulmigu Nallakathayee Amman Temple Festival schedule on 02.02.2017 at Mannangadu, Pattukottai Taluk, Thanjavur District.

ORDER
[Order of the Court was made by A.SELVAM, J.] This writ petition has been fil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to direct the respondents to convene Peace Committee Meeting for the purpose of getting contribution from all community people in connection with the temple festival mentioned in the petition, by way of issuing a writ of mandamus. 2.Mr.M.Govindan, learned Special Government Pleader, has taken notice for the respondents.

3.It is seen from the records that on 10.01.2017, a representation has been given to the respondents, but the same has not been considered.
4.The learned Special Government Pleader appearing for the respondents has represented that already a Peace Committee Meeting has been convened and the festival is going to be started on 02.02.2017 and further the festival organisers have not been impleaded.
5.Considering the aforesaid factual circumstances, this Court is inclined to pass the following order. 6.In fine, this writ petition is allowed in part without costs and the third respondent viz., Tahsildar, Pattukottai, Thanjavur District is directed to look into the representation dated 10.01.2017 and dispose of the same immediately.
